Main information about car part TOYOTA 90098-66033
Producer TOYOTA
Number 90098-66033 / 9009866033
Group Spark Plug
Description Spark Plug
Analogue of TOYOTA 90098-66033
ALFA ROMEO ALFA ROMEO 0948200322 0948200322 Spark Plug
ALFA ROMEO ALFA ROMEO 148LUR 148LUR Spark Plug
ALFA ROMEO ALFA ROMEO 2403A 2403A Spark Plug
ALFA ROMEO ALFA ROMEO A14AB A14AB Spark Plug
ALFA ROMEO ALFA ROMEO BP5EKN BP5EKN Spark Plug
ALFA ROMEO ALFA ROMEO BP5ES BP5ES Spark Plug
ALFA ROMEO ALFA ROMEO BP5EV BP5EV Spark Plug
ALFA ROMEO ALFA ROMEO BP5EVX BP5EVX Spark Plug
ALFA ROMEO ALFA ROMEO BP5EVX11 BP5EVX11 Spark Plug
ALFA ROMEO ALFA ROMEO C32LS C32LS Spark Plug
ALFA ROMEO ALFA ROMEO GR4GP GR4GP Spark Plug
ALFA ROMEO ALFA ROMEO GR4VX GR4VX Spark Plug
ALFA ROMEO ALFA ROMEO GR5VX GR5VX Spark Plug
ALFA ROMEO ALFA ROMEO GSP2013 GSP2013 Spark Plug
ALFA ROMEO ALFA ROMEO LR17YS LR17YS Spark Plug
ALFA ROMEO ALFA ROMEO N12YC N12YC Spark Plug
ALFA ROMEO ALFA ROMEO RC52LZE RC52LZE Spark Plug
ALFA ROMEO ALFA ROMEO RN9LCC RN9LCC Spark Plug
ALFA ROMEO ALFA ROMEO W8DPV W8DPV Spark Plug
ALFA ROMEO ALFA ROMEO W8DPX W8DPX Spark Plug
ALFA ROMEO ALFA ROMEO W8LCR W8LCR Spark Plug
ALFA ROMEO ALFA ROMEO W8LPR W8LPR Spark Plug
ALFA ROMEO ALFA ROMEO WR8DP WR8DP Spark Plug
ALFA ROMEO ALFA ROMEO ZGR5A ZGR5A Spark Plug
ALFA ROMEO ALFA ROMEO ZGR5AGP ZGR5AGP Spark Plug
ALFA ROMEO ALFA ROMEO ZGR5B ZGR5B Spark Plug
ALFA ROMEO ALFA ROMEO ZGR5E ZGR5E Spark Plug
AUDI AUDI 0021592203 0021592203 Spark Plug
AUDI AUDI 0021592903 0021592903 Spark Plug
AUDI AUDI 0021593103 0021593103 Spark Plug
AUDI AUDI 0021594803 0021594803 Spark Plug
AUDI AUDI 0031591003 0031591003 Spark Plug
AUDI AUDI 0031591103 0031591103 Spark Plug
AUDI AUDI 0031592703 0031592703 Spark Plug
AUDI AUDI 0031592903 0031592903 Spark Plug
AUDI AUDI 0031594603 0031594603 Spark Plug
AUDI AUDI 0031594703 0031594703 Spark Plug
AUDI AUDI 089220101883 089220101883 Spark Plug
AUDI AUDI 0948200123 0948200123 Spark Plug
AUDI AUDI 0948200131 0948200131 Spark Plug
AUDI AUDI 0948200132 0948200132 Spark Plug
AUDI AUDI 0948200322 0948200322 Spark Plug
AUDI AUDI 153418110 153418110 Spark Plug
AUDI AUDI 22401W8915 22401W8915 Spark Plug
AUDI AUDI 3231077 3231077 Spark Plug
AUDI AUDI 3232791 3232791 Spark Plug
AUDI AUDI 420545402 420545402 Spark Plug
AUDI AUDI 420547102 420547102 Spark Plug
AUDI AUDI 482415700 482415700 Spark Plug
AUDI AUDI 5099751 5099751 Spark Plug
AUDI AUDI 5813800050 5813800050 Spark Plug
AUDI AUDI 5813800070 5813800070 Spark Plug
AUDI AUDI 5R6AG 5R6AG Spark Plug
AUDI AUDI 7700860235 7700860235 Spark Plug
AUDI AUDI 7700862054 7700862054 Spark Plug
AUDI AUDI 7700869200 7700869200 Spark Plug
AUDI AUDI 7701041214 7701041214 Spark Plug
AUDI AUDI 7701366539 7701366539 Spark Plug
AUDI AUDI 7701366903 7701366903 Spark Plug
AUDI AUDI 834236MI 834236MI Spark Plug
AUDI AUDI 9004851036000 9004851036000 Spark Plug
AUDI AUDI 9004851047000 9004851047000 Spark Plug
AUDI AUDI 9004851053000 9004851053000 Spark Plug
AUDI AUDI 9009866032 9009866032 Spark Plug
AUDI AUDI 9009866033 9009866033 Spark Plug
AUDI AUDI 9050714 9050714 Spark Plug
AUDI AUDI 9091901027 9091901027 Spark Plug
AUDI AUDI 9091901027000 9091901027000 Spark Plug
AUDI AUDI 9091901041 9091901041 Spark Plug
AUDI AUDI 9091901059 9091901059 Spark Plug
AUDI AUDI 9091901059000 9091901059000 Spark Plug
AUDI AUDI 9091901059007 9091901059007 Spark Plug
AUDI AUDI 9091901077 9091901077 Spark Plug
AUDI AUDI 9091951072000 9091951072000 Spark Plug
AUDI AUDI 9099909006 9099909006 Spark Plug
AUDI AUDI 920701052 920701052 Spark Plug
AUDI AUDI 9825131060 9825131060 Spark Plug
AUDI AUDI 9900079A3716E 9900079A3716E Spark Plug
AUDI AUDI 9900079A37W6X 9900079A37W6X Spark Plug
AUDI AUDI 99917013290 99917013290 Spark Plug
AUDI AUDI 99917013390 99917013390 Spark Plug
AUDI AUDI 99917013690 99917013690 Spark Plug
AUDI AUDI 99917017090 99917017090 Spark Plug
AUDI AUDI B240189904 B240189904 Spark Plug
AUDI AUDI EVS13P EVS13P Spark Plug
AUDI AUDI EVS13S EVS13S Spark Plug
AUDI AUDI LBP5ES LBP5ES Spark Plug
AUDI AUDI MS851022 MS851022 Spark Plug
AUDI AUDI MS851097 MS851097 Spark Plug
AUDI AUDI MS851102 MS851102 Spark Plug
AUDI AUDI MS851243 MS851243 Spark Plug
AUDI AUDI MS851437 MS851437 Spark Plug
AUDI AUDI R84HZY R84HZY Spark Plug
DENSO DENSO W16EXR-ZU W16EXRZU Spark Plug
NGK NGK 5470 5470 Spark Plug
NGK NGK 6597 6597 Spark Plug
NGK NGK 7524 7524 Spark Plug
TOYOTA TOYOTA 9009816585 9009816585 Spark Plug
TOYOTA TOYOTA 9091901081 9091901081 Spark Plug
The other parts with the same number "9009866033"
AUDI 9009866033 Spark Plug
LEXUS 90098-66033 Spark Plug